Sherwin Iron increases resource at Roper River iron ore project

Monday, 05 September 2011 12:23:24 (GMT+3)   |  
       

On September 5, Autralia-based iron ore exploration and development company Sherwin Iron Limited (Sherwin Iron), which owns 100 percent of the 4,000 km2 Roper River iron ore project in Australia's Northern Territory, announced a substantial increase in the resource estimate for its iron ore project, with the overall tonnage of hematite mineralization increasing by 58 percent to 168 million metric tons at 44.7 percent Fe.

Sherwin Iron is an emerging iron ore company which has a current resource of 107 million mt from its initial exploration activities with an exploration target of 400-500 million mt of 40-48 percent Fe from two of its five tenement areas.
